Compression is an important field of digital image processing where well-engineered methods with high performance exist. Partial differential equations (PDEs), however, have not much been explored in this context so far. In our paper we introduce a novel framework for image compression that makes use of the interpolation qualities of edge-enhancing diffusion. Although this anisotropic diffusion equation with a diffusion tensor was originally proposed for image denoising, we show that it outperforms many other PDEs when sparse scattered data must be interpolated. To exploit this property for image compression, we consider an adaptive triangulation method for remov- ing less significant pixels from the image. The remaining points serve as scattered interpolation data for the diffusion process. They can be coded in a compact way that reflects the B-tree structure of the triangulation. We supplement the coding step with a number of amendments such as error threshold adaptation, diffusion-based point selection, and specific quantisation strategies. Our experiments illustrate the usefulness of each of these modifications. They demonstrate that for high compression rates, our PDE-based approach does not only give far better results than the widelyused JPEG standard, but can even come close to the quality of the highly optimised JPEG2000 codec.
While methods based on partial differential equations (PDEs) and variational techniques are powerful tools for denoising and inpainting digital images, their use for image compression was mainly focussing on pre-or postprocessing so far. In our paper we investigate their potential within the decoding step. We start with the observation that edge-enhancing diffusion (EED), an anisotropic nonlinear diffusion filter with a diffusion tensor, is well-suited for scattered data interpolation: Even when the interpolation data are very sparse, good results are obtained that respect discontinuities and satisfy a maximumminimum principle. This property is exploited in our studies on PDE-based image compression. We use an adaptive triangulation method based on B-tree coding for removing less significant pixels from the image. The remaining points serve as scattered interpolation data for the EED process. They can be coded in a compact and elegant way that reflects the B-tree structure. Our experiments illustrate that for high compression rates and non-textured images, this PDE-based approach gives visually better results than the widely-used JPEG coding.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.